Juniper Networks has announced that James Cook University Singapore (JCU Singapore) deployed Juniper’s cloud-delivered wireless access solutions driven by Mist AI for upgrades to its campus network.

With the Juniper Access Points, JCU Singapore has built an AI-driven wireless network that supports its drive towards creating a technology-enhanced education program, delivering seamless blended learning experiences for its students.

Fully owned by JCU Australia and ranked in the top 2% of universities in the world, the Singapore campus was established in 2003 as part of its commitment to internationalize its operations.

In addition to its research programs, the university offers a range of university-level programs spanning various disciplines, including Business, Tourism & Hospitality, Information Technology, Education and Psychology.

During the pandemic, the university conducted over 60,000 online learning and teaching sessions before resuming full campus operations in 2022. In response to students’ feedback for JCU Singapore to continue providing a flexible learning environment, the university embarked on an ambitious project to offer most courses through a blended learning approach.

Additionally, as the student population grew (surpassing the 2022 target by 6%), the university recognized the need for a more robust network to support their evolving mobility requirements.

Building on a long-term relationship that spans across its campuses in Australia and Singapore, JCU Singapore teamed up with Juniper to overhaul its campus wireless network.

The university deployed the Juniper AP43 and AP63 Wireless Access Points across its facilities – including its lecture and seminar rooms, libraries, labs, aquaculture research centers and sports facilities – ensuring comprehensive high-speed wireless coverage across the entire campus.

Using Juniper’s Mist AI and Cloud, the university’s IT team deployed the APs campus-wide, establishing the wireless network before the school term and achieving comprehensive network visibility through a unified management interface.

The APs work in conjunction with Juniper Mist Wi-Fi Assurance, enabling the IT team to swiftly resolve Wi-Fi issues by pinpointing their source.
